R 类型提供程序与数据框的强大应用
1. R 类型提供程序简介
R 是一个用于统计计算和图形处理的免费软件环境,由统计学家为统计学家设计和实现。它是开源且完全免费的,拥有一个由 R 社区创建的庞大包生态系统,几乎涵盖了统计学的各个领域。
R 类型提供程序的独特之处在于,它能让我们在 F# 环境中使用 R 语言及其相关包。前提是我们的机器上已经安装了 R,可从 R 官方网站 获取安装说明和文档。不过,在撰写本文时,R 类型提供程序在 Mono 上仅部分受支持。
要使用 R 类型提供程序,我们需要安装 NuGet 包 RProvider,并在脚本中添加必要的引用:
#r @"R.NET.Community.1.5.16\lib\net40\RDotNet.dll"
#r @"RProvider.1.1.8\lib\net40\RProvider.Runtime.dll"
#r @"RProvider.1.1.8\lib\net40\RProvider.dll"
open RProvider
open RProvider.``base``
open RProvider.graphics
添加引用后,我们就可以打开各种 R 包并使用它们。例如,打开 base 和 graphics 包,这两个包提供了基本函数和图表功能。当我们输入 open RProvider. 时,IntelliSense 会显示计算机上实际存在的包。
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



